My DVD works when used as a boot disk in BIOS (can use my windows XP disk) which suggests that its working ok.But no icon in device manager or my computer. I've tried removing the upper & lower filters in regedit but this has not solved the problem. Any other ideas please

try changing youre hd driveletters(not the c offcourse). One of your hd's might have the smae driveletter as the dvd. Also check youre device manager if you can see the dvd there
